Coal binder is a key material in the production process of coal, and its performance directly affects the strength, combustion efficiency, environmental friendliness, and production cost of coal. The following is an analysis of the effect of using coal binder to produce coal:
1. Improve the strength of coal form
Coal binder significantly improves the mechanical strength and compressive performance of coal by bonding coal powder particles, making it less prone to breakage during transportation and use. High strength coal can reduce transportation losses, prolong combustion time, and improve combustion efficiency.
2. Improve combustion performance
Coal binder can optimize the combustion characteristics of coal, improve the utilization rate of calorific value, and reduce harmful gases produced by incomplete combustion. More complete combustion, higher thermal efficiency, and reduced environmental pollution.
3. Improving environmental performance: Coal binder can fix sulfur and other harmful substances in coal powder, reducing the emission of pollutants such as sulfur dioxide and nitrogen oxides during combustion. Meet environmental requirements and reduce negative impacts on the environment.
4. Reduce production costs
By using a coal binder, the amount of raw coal used can be reduced, while also lowering energy consumption and labor costs during the production process.
Improve economic efficiency and be suitable for large-scale production.
5. Strong adaptability
Modern coal binder can be adjusted according to different coal types and production processes, and is suitable for various types of coal powder and forming equipment.
High flexibility and wide applicability.
6. Improve the waterproofness of the molded coal
Part of the coal binder has waterproof function, which can improve the moisture resistance of the coal and extend the storage time. Reduce the decrease in quality of coal due to moisture, and facilitate long-term storage and transportation.
7. Promote resource utilization
Coal binder can convert low-quality coal powder or gangue resources into efficient coal, improving resource utilization efficiency. Reduce resource waste and promote sustainable development.
8. Easy to operate
Coal binder is usually easy to add and mix, with a simple production process and suitable for large-scale industrial production. Reduce production difficulty and improve production efficiency.
